Pilates is built on control, alignment, and consistency, making it a sustainable way to stay active.
Pilates trains the body as a connected system rather than isolating muscles. This improves coordination and helps correct movement imbalances caused by poor posture or repetitive habits. As strength develops, clients often experience reduced discomfort and greater confidence in daily movement.
A major benefit of Pilates is joint protection. Exercises are designed to strengthen muscles without compressing or stressing the joints. This makes pilates classes in las vegas ideal for people managing back pain, joint sensitivity, or previous injuries. Movements are smooth, controlled, and adaptable to different ability levels.
Reformer Pilates enhances this experience by providing controlled resistance. The equipment supports proper form while challenging muscles in a balanced way. This approach improves flexibility, stability, and strength simultaneously, creating efficient and effective workouts.
Another reason Pilates stands out is consistency. Sessions are challenging but manageable, making it easier to stay committed. Instead of extreme fatigue, clients leave feeling stronger and more aligned. Over time, this leads to noticeable improvements in posture, balance, and movement quality.
Pilates also supports longevity. By focusing on foundational strength and mobility, it helps prevent common issues that arise with aging or sedentary lifestyles. The skills learned in class carry over into everyday life, improving overall movement awareness.
